Preferred Allowance definition

Preferred Allowance means the amount a Preferred Provider will accept as payment in full for Covered Medical Expenses.
Preferred Allowance means the amount a Network Provider will accept as payment in full for Covered Charges.
Preferred Allowance means the amount a Preferred Provider will accept as payment in full for Covered Medical Expenses. “Out of Network” providers have not agreed to any prearranged fee schedules. You may incur significant out-of-pocket expenses with these providers. Charges in excess of the insurance payment are your responsibility. Regardless of the provider, you are responsible for the payment of your Deductible. You must satisfy your Deductible before benefits are paid. We will pay according to the benefit limits in the Schedule of Medical Expense Benefits.
